#39c614 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39c614 is composed of 22.4% red, 77.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.9%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#39c614 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ff28 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#39c614 color description : Strong lime green.

#39c614 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#39c614 has RGB values of R:57, G:198,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 3786260.

Shades and Tints of #39c614

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f2fd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#39c614

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7268 is the less saturated color, while #2fd703 is the most saturated one.
